Michael Jackson Named Highest-Paid Deceased Celebrity in 2016 According to Forbes

Forbes just rolled out its list of the highest-paid dead celebrities of 2016. According to the report, it turns out that Michael Jackson is the top earner, raking in $825 million USD for the year. How did this come to be?  For one, there was the sale in March of Michael Jackson’s half of the Sony/ATV music publishing catalog — this includes the Beatles music works and was valued at $750 million USD. Also included in the list are music legends John Lennon (bringing in $12 million USD), Prince (totaling $25 million USD), and Elvis Presley (at $27 million USD). Non musical celebrities also consisted of Albert Einstein, Theador Geiel “Dr. Seuss,” and Charlz Schulz. See the the top 10 list below.

10. Bettie Page – $11 million
9. Albert Einstein – $11.5 million
8. John Lennon – $12 million
7. Theador Geiel “Dr. Seuss” – $20 million
6. Bob Marley – $21 million
5. Prince – $25 million
4. Elvis Presley – $27 million
3. Arnold Palmer – $40 million
2. Charles Schulz – $48 million
1. Michael Jackson – $825 million
